Structural lifting services involve the precise raising and stabilization of a building or its parts to address foundational or structural issues. This process typically includes lifting entire structures, such as homes or commercial buildings, to correct uneven settling, foundation failure, or other structural problems.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ment to lift and support the property safely, allowing for repairs or improvements to be made underneath or to the foundation itself. This service is essential when a property’s stability is compromised, helping to restore safety and prevent further damage.
Many property owners seek structural lifting when experiencing issues like uneven floors, cracked walls, or doors and windows that no longer align properly. These signs often indicate that the building’s foundation has shifted or settled unevenly over time. Structural lifting can also be used to repair damage caused by water intrusion, soil movement, or previous construction work that has compromised the integrity of the foundation. By addressing these problems early, homeowners can avoid more costly repairs down the line and ensure their property remains safe and functional.

The overview below groups typical Structural Lifting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mount Vernon,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or structural lifting projects, such as foundation adjustments or pier jacking, range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the specifics of the work needed.
Moderate Projects - Larger, more involved lifting services like basement stabilization or partial foundation lifts generally cost between $1,000-$3,500. These projects are common for homeowners addressing ongoing settling issues.
Major Lifting Services - Complex structural lifts, including significant foundation replacements or large-scale stabilization, can range from $4,000-$10,000 or more. Fewer projects reach this tier, typically reserved for extensive or challenging jobs.
Full Replacement or Extensive Repairs - Complete foundation replacements or extensive structural overhauls may exceed $15,000, with costs varying based on size and complexity. Local contractors can provide detailed estimates tailored to specific project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of structures can be lifted with structural lifting services? Local contractors can handle a variety of structures including buildings, bridges, and heavy equipment to ensure safe and precise lifting.
How do structural lifting services ensure safety during the process? Service providers follow established safety protocols and use specialized equipment to minimize risks during lifting operations.
What equipment is typically used for structural lifting projects? Heavy-duty cranes, jacks, and rigging gear are commonly employed by local contractors to perform various lifting tasks.
Can structural lifting services help with foundation or load-bearing issues? Yes, experienced service providers can assist with foundation stabilization, reinforcement, and load redistribution as needed.
What factors influence the choice of lifting method for a project? The type of structure, weight, location, and site conditions are key considerations that local professionals evaluate to determine the appropriate approach.
